1. Open Source Intelligence (OSINT)
OSINT is the process of collecting information from openly available sources. This is not restricted to a simple Google search. It includes scraping social media archives, searching cached versions of sites, and cross-referencing public databases to build a comprehensive profile of an individual or entity.
2. Social Media Forensics
In cases of disparagement or harassment, an investigator can trace the origin of "burner" accounts. By examining publishing patterns, linguistic finger prints, and associated metadata, they can frequently link a confidential profile to a real-world identity.

The Investigative Process: A Step-by-Step Breakdown
A professional digital investigation follows a structured approach to guarantee that the findings are precise and, if needed, admissible in a law court.
Assessment and Scoping: The investigator specifies what the client needs to find and determines the technical feasibility of the demand.Data Acquisition: The investigator secures the information. Is it legal to hire a hacker for an investigation?
It depends on the scope. Hiring an ethical hacker for OSINT, information recovery on your own gadgets, or examining public records is legal. However, employing somebody to bypass security on a third-party server without authorization is a violation of the Computer Fraud and Abuse Act (CFAA) in the United States and similar laws worldwide.

3. Can a hacker recover erased WhatsApp or Telegram messages?
If the investigator has physical access to the device and the information hasn't been overwritten by new info, it is frequently possible to recuperate erased data from the gadget's database files. However, intercepting "live" encrypted messages from another location is generally impossible for private detectives.
